zink: reset PIPE_CAP_ACCELERATED when cpu soft rendering
authorQiang Yu <yuq825@gmail.com>
Sat, 21 May 2022 07:35:39 +0000 (15:35 +0800)
committerMarge Bot <emma+marge@anholt.net>
Mon, 6 Jun 2022 18:23:49 +0000 (18:23 +0000)
commit1b3fd8b3d2d290d6ae2a47312b2e884d864885a1
tree302700336569d906aed25e54fcab39d26b7214a7
parent9b22ab4167e6c2c0cf8868a9109545fe2c0d164b
zink: reset PIPE_CAP_ACCELERATED when cpu soft rendering

This field can be used to disable some unsupport/unproper hardware
acceleration. Reset it when zink is runing on cpu rendering.

Reviewed-by: Mike Blumenkrantz <michael.blumenkrantz@gmail.com>
Signed-off-by: Qiang Yu <yuq825@gmail.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/15765>
src/gallium/drivers/zink/zink_screen.c